    Even if it's only 10 minutes to start, just start walking every day. Add on 5 minutes every week. I weigh 400 lbs. I walk an hour a day. I go fairly slow. I up the speed for a few minutes when I feel I can, and then drop it down again because for me, that 60 minutes is my goal. I can do a faster pace for 30 minutes, but I prefer to go for a bit slower, because it keeps me moving more for longer.

    I keep myself in my target heart rate. ANY type of additional movement will be beneficial to you, if you are completely sedentary right now. Your body will adjust. Push yourself gently, but stop if you ultimately need to stop. It will get a little easier each time, I promise.

    You are fit enough now to start a walk program. Set some goals for yourself - maybe a 1/2 mile to start. Walking is the best way to get moving. Running will come with time, but walk first. Get you body used to moving, getting your heart rate up, and being active on a schedule. Once it is used to that, you will know when you are ready for running. If you jump into running too soon, you will get discouraged. What you start running, start with a walk/run program to build endurance, breathing, etc.
